The State of Missouri, through the OA Division of Facilities Management Design and Construction Operations, is issuing a single feasible source solicitation for parts and labor related to the Automated Logic Control System for the West Region. This procurement, identified as solicitation number OA FMDC OPERATION 0000000069SL and SFS No. S27-017, is designated for the acquisition of automation control devices and components. Control Service Company, Inc. has been identified as the sole-source provider due to its status as the Automated Logic Controls dealer with exclusive territorial rights for the specified Missouri facilities. The solicitation was posted on August 25, 2026, with a response deadline of September 1, 2026. The resulting contract or blanket purchase agreement will cover a period from the date of award for one year, with the option for two additional renewal periods. This procurement falls under NAICS code 334514 and is managed by buyer Jamie Fergison.

Janitorial Services - Jefferson City
Solicitation # JLJC270010
The State of Missouri Office of Administration, Division of Facilities Management, Design and Construction, is soliciting competitive bids for a Blanket Purchase Agreement to provide janitorial services at a state-leased facility located at 3411 Knipp Drive, Suite A, Jefferson City, Missouri. The contract covers a 7,247 square foot facility with a primary performance period from January 1, 2027, to December 31, 2027, and includes options for three additional one-year renewal periods. Services include routine cleaning five times per week, as well as supplemental services such as interior and exterior window cleaning, floor stripping and waxing, deep carpet cleaning, and construction clean-up. Bids are due by October 15, 2026, at 2:00 PM CT, and must be submitted electronically via the MissouriBUYS portal. Award decisions will be based on the lowest and best vendor evaluation, considering total annual costs for both routine and supplemental services. Vendors must submit a comprehensive set of exhibits, including pricing, past performance references, and business certifications. Key requirements include the use of environmentally preferable products, strict adherence to OSHA Hazard Communication Standards for chemical labeling and Safety Data Sheets, and the maintenance of blood spill kits on each floor. Additionally, the contractor and its employees must undergo fingerprint-based background checks through the Missouri State Highway Patrol at least 45 days prior to starting work. Payment is processed via Electronic Funds Transfer within 45 calendar days of receiving a valid invoice.
